  • Abstract
    This paper presents a general description of the mode coupling in the optical waveguide containing a magnetostatic forward volume wave(MSFVW). The power-conversion efficiency of TEI-TMm modes have been obtained for several kinds of 1/m, which are corresponding to the different center frequency. The multi-band modulator has been predicted and the advantage of modulation by MSFVW over MSSW has been discussed.
